Subject: Quickstore 4.2 — bloom filter now fronts the KV layer

Plugin authors: starting with this release, Quickstore places a bloom filter ahead of the key-value store. Negative lookups return faster; false positives fall through safely. No API changes are required on your side. Verify your plugin against the staging build referenced below.

session token of fahif-tadup = htk3_9c7

### Item 14 — Alert Fan-Out Authorization

Verify that the Stormgate weather-alert fan-out service enforces signed payloads on every downstream push, including the low-priority advisory queue. Confirm that retry workers cannot replay expired alerts and that the regional topic list is reconciled against the canonical registry nightly. Any mismatch must be logged to the tamper-evident audit stream within five minutes. Review the access roster for the fan-out admin role quarterly. The accountable owner for this control is recorded below.

named custodian: Oliath Ralax

Don't hardcode the Brindlewave update channel in `ota_client.c`. Pull it from the provisioning blob like the Kestrelgate units do, otherwise field devices stuck on `beta` never migrate. Also the retry backoff here is too aggressive for cellular links. I moved the channel and retry knobs into one struct so they're auditable. Current defaults are as follows.

tuning table, faduf-baduf:
PRIORITIES = {
    "ulavan": 191,
    "silys": 750,
    "goriel": 238,
    "kelmir": 66,
    "wendor": 432,
}

## Build Provenance: Streamlatch Reconnect Fix

The websocket reconnect bug in Streamlatch caused duplicate session handshakes after idle timeouts longer than ninety seconds. The fix landed in the 4.2 maintenance branch and was cherry-picked into the release candidate by the Harwick team. Please verify the patched artifact originated from the sealed pipeline, not a developer workstation, before signing off. The attested trace for the candidate build appears below.

pipeline stamp: htk31_f769b577b3028a4e9958e5bb8d1259a